You can find the ones listed in your post on ebay or nengun.com, my friend's aristo came from japan with the ones installed from the OP. The beam output and cutoff is actually pretty good, and a lot better than the stock GS400 HID reflectors. Make sure you buy the LHD beam pattern though.

ahh i see, im in the dallas area, if you were closer i could help you out. the site "theretrofitsource.com" tmf2004 suggested is a site that sells parts for retrofits. they dont have anything that is already built. they do sell top notch stuff tho, i got all my retro stuff from them. also hit up tony from luxurymods his got the brackets for the projectors to simplify the retrofit.

Some kind of retrofit is definitely the way to go, quality projectors designed for HID bulbs will have so much better output than the eBay headlights. theretrofitsource and luxurymods will both be good resources. Do it right the first time and do a proper retrofit!
